الجلسة الخاضعة للمعاملاتتدعم سلسلة واحدة من المعاملات. تقوم كل معاملة بتجميع مجموعة من الرسائل المنتجة ومجموعة من الرسائل المستهلكة في وحدة الذرية للعمل. في الواقع ، تنظم المعاملات تدفق رسائل الإدخال للجلسة وتدفق رسائل الإخراج إلى سلسلة من الوحدات الذرية.
ما هي الجلسة الخاضعة للمعاملات؟
المعاملاتتسمح لك بتجميع سلسلة كاملة من الرسائل الواردة والصادرة معًا والتعامل معها كوحدة ذرية. يتتبع وسيط الرسائل حالة الرسائل الفردية للمعاملة ، لكنه لا يكمل تسليمها حتى تقوم بتنفيذ المعاملة.
ما هي الجلسة في JMS؟
كائن الجلسة هوسياق مترابط واحد لإنتاج الرسائل واستهلاكها. على الرغم من أنه قد يخصص موارد الموفر خارج جهاز Java الظاهري (JVM) ، إلا أنه يعتبر كائن JMS خفيف الوزن. تخدم الجلسة عدة أغراض: إنها مصنع لمنتجي رسالتها ومستهلكيها.
ما هو الإقرار في JMS؟
الإقرار هوالطريقة التي يخبر بها المستهلك موفر JMS أنه قد استقبل بنجاح رسالة. من جانب المنتج ، يتكون المفهوم الوحيد للإقرار من استدعاء ناجح إما لطريقة نشر الموضوع أو طريقة الإرسال الخاصة بمرسل قائمة الانتظار.
ما هو تكامل JMS؟
موارد قائمة انتظار JMS (قوائم الانتظار ومصانع اتصال قائمة الانتظار)يتم توفيرها من قبل موفر الرسائل الافتراضي للرسائل من نقطة إلى نقطة JMS ومدعومة من قبل ناقل تكامل الخدمة. … كل عضوين لهما قائمة انتظار JMS. يرسل أحد التطبيقات رسائل إلى قائمة انتظار JMS ويسترد الرسائل من قائمة انتظار JMS الأخرى.